2 Samuel 14:1-6 International Children’s Bible (ICB)

1. Joab son of Zeruiah knew that King David missed Absalom very much.

2. So Joab sent messengers to Tekoa to bring a wise woman from there. Joab said to her, “Please pretend to be very sad for someone. Put on clothes to show your sadness. Don’t put lotion on yourself. Act like a woman who has been crying many days for someone who died.

3. Go to the king. Talk to him using the words that I tell you.” Then Joab told the wise woman what to say.

4. So the woman from Tekoa talked to the king. She bowed facedown on the ground to show respect. She said, “My king, help me!”

5. King David asked her, “What is the matter?”The woman said, “I am a widow. My husband is dead.

6. I had two sons. They were out in the field fighting. No one was there to stop them. So one son killed the other son.
